Transesterification for the preparation of Biodiesel from Crude Oil of Milk Bush

In this research study, biodiesel was produced via transesterification process from the crude oil of milk bush (thevetia peruviana) with methanol as alcohol. Two molar ratio 1:6 and 1:10 of oil to methanol was used to determine the conversion rate at two different temperature 45 and 60oC. Sodium hydroxide was used as catalyst at. The experiment was carried out at atmospheric pressure. The reaction was carried out in a batchtype reaction vessel. The results obtained shows that a maximum conversion of 94% of oil to methyl ester was achieved at 60oC with molar ratio 1:10 of oil to methanol. The biodiesel produced agrees with ASTM and German standards.
